Bitcoin's appeal as a hedge against inflation has been evident since the post-pandemic period in 2020, demonstrating its enduring value amidst macroeconomic instability. As of June 27, 2025, Bitcoin is valued at $107,100.98, with a market cap of $2.13 trillion and a dominance of 65.04%. Its 24-hour volume hit $45.49 billion, revealing a 0.48% decline. Over 90 days, BTC rose by 29.75%.
